DaniLeigh Says She's Sorry For Dropping 'Yellow Bone' Song

Singer DaniLeigh found herself in a heap of controversy after releasing her cut "Yellow Bone" last week, and she's since apologized.

The Miami native was accused of colorism after people heard the song, and during her initial response she asked why people are taking it "so personally?"

But DaniLeigh — who's dating DaBaby — used a softer approach in her new apology and said she now understands why some are angry with her.

"I think people twisted it into thinking, like, I'm trying to bash another woman, another skin tone, that was never my intention," she explained. "I wasn't brought up like that. I never looked at my skin as a privilege. I never looked at me as 'I'm better than somebody because of my skin tone.'" 

"I see brown skin women flaunt their skin all the time in music. Why can't I talk about mine?" DaniLeigh continued. "If you look at me, I'm light-skinned, I'm a yellow bone. In my opinion, that's just what I am. So it wasn't something that I looked at so deeply, which I can see why people will take it deeply. So I understand and I'm sorry that I wasn’t sensitive to the topic when I wrote my comment 'Why are you guys taking so personal?' Because it can be a personal thing to certain people, because colorist is a real thing so I do get it. But I'm not that. I’m not a colorist. I’m not a racist. I date a whole chocolate man. I have beautiful dark-skinned friends."
